Summary
Conquer your fears and understand the most common math concepts used in nursing practice today
Table Of Contents
Safety in medication administration -- The drug label -- The metric system -- The household system -- Linear ratio and proportion -- Fractional ratio and proportion -- Dimensional analysis -- The formula method -- Calculating oral medication doses -- Syringes and needles -- Calculating parenteral medication doses -- Preparing powdered parenteral medications -- Administering insulin -- Intravenous therapy and infusion rates -- Calculating infusion and completion time -- Administering direct iv medications -- Verifying safe dose -- Titration of intravenous medications -- Calculating intake and output -- Parenteral intake -- Considerations for the pediatric population -- Considerations for the older adult population
